Did DESI BOYZ deserve an 'adults only' certificate?

Entire team of DESI BOYZ has been left stunned. The film, which they were proudly marketing as a family entertainer all along, has been granted an 'A' certificate by the censor board, something that they just didn't see coming. Though they felt that the film was a light hearted entertainer and had even termed it as a dramedy, the board apparently felt that the theme of 'male escorts' was perhaps a little too risqué for universal audience.
 
"This decision is bizarre to say the least. One wonders what the real argument of censor board here was but this is simply not done," says a senior crew member who didn't wish to be named, "All this is real disappointing."
 
The makers further argue that even a song like <i>'Tu Mera Hero'</i> (where Akshay and John strip while dancing for the ladies) was handled with kid gloves as it was made to look cute-n-naughty instead of sensual.
 
"So much precaution was taken while making the film but still there was no room left for any argument whatsoever when DESI BOYZ was deemed unfit for audience below 18 year of age," the crew member continues.
 
This pretty much reminds one of some of the other confrontations that took place early this year when Ajay Devgn-Emraan Hashmi starrer DIL TOH BACCHA HAI JI was handed an 'A' certificate due to theme of adultery as well as reference to porn and other hints around sex. On the other hand PYAAR KA PUNCHNAMA maker Luv Ranjan was quite vocal on his angst against censor board which had asked for number of cuts in the film since it spoke about live-in relationship.
 
Nevertheless, whatever may have happened for films that were released early this year, as of now it is DESI BOYZ team which is facing the heat and it would be up to the audience to judge whether verdict passed by censor board was indeed justified or not.
